IMPORTANT
FACTS
Your furnace must have adequate airflow for el_cient coin-
bustion and safe ventilation.
Do not enclose it in an airtight
room or "seal" it behind solid doors.
To minimize the possibility of serious personal injury, fire,
furnace damage, or improper operation;
carefully
follow
these safety rules:
• Keep the area around your furnace tree of combustible
materials, gasoline, and other flammable liquids and vapors.
5
• Do not cover the flmmce, store trash or debris near it, or
in any way block the flow of fresh air to the unit.
• Colnbustion
air must be clean and uncontaminated
with
chlorine or fluorine. These compounds
are present in
many products around the home, such as: water softener
salts, laundry bleaches, detergents, adhesives, paints, var-
nishes, paint strippers, waxes, and plastics.
Make sure the Colnbustion air for your furnace does not con-
tain any of these compounds. During remodeling be sure the
colnbnstion air is fresh and uncontaminated.
If these coin-
pounds are burned in ymir fltrnace, the heat exchangers
and
metal vent system may deteriorate.
• A flmmce installed in an attic or other insulated space
must be kept tree and clear of insulating material. Examine
the furnace area when installing the furnace or adding more
insulation. Some materials may be combustible.
NOTE: Do not use this furnace if any part has been under
water. Ilnmediately
call a qualified service technician to
inspect the furnace and to replace any part of the control
system and any gas control which has been under water.
NOTE: The qualified installer or agency must use only
factory-authorized
replacement
parts, kits, and accessories
when modifying this product.
This furnace contains safety devices which must be manu-
ally reset. If the furnace is left unattended
for an extended
period of time, have it checked periodically
for proper oper-
ation. This precaution will prevent problems associated
with no heat, such as frozen water pipes, etc. See "Before
You Request a Service Call" section in this lnaimal.
SAFETY CONSIDERATIONS
Installing and servicing heating equiplnem can be hazard-
ous due to gas and electrical COlnponents. Only trained and
qualified personnel should install, repair, or service heating
equipment.
